What is good literature?

Great literature is based on ideas that are startling, unexpected, unusual, weighty. or new. Great literature makes us see or think things we never did before. The ideas underpinning the work challenge our accustomed categories and ways of thinking, putting minds on edge.

What makes English literature unique?

English has more words than most languages, and those words have come from many different sources from all over the world. Shakespeare was a master at using the English language to compose great literature, using its wealth of words to compose brilliant speeches and witty puns.

What is English literature introduction?

Introduction to English Literature Literature is the reflection of life. The word literature comes from the Latin word ‘litaritura’ meaning “writing organized with letters”. We classify literature according to language, origin, historical period, genre, and subject matter.
